The cost of handicap rail installation in Fairfield, CA can vary significantly based on several factors. Ensuring accessibility and safety for individuals with mobility challenges is crucial, and understanding the financial aspects involved can help you plan better. Here’s a detailed look into the costs and the factors that influence them.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Material Choice: The type of material used, such as stainless steel, aluminum, or wood, can greatly impact the cost.
  • Length of Rails: Longer rails require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
  • Installation Complexity: More complex installations, such as those requiring custom designs or additional support structures, can be more expensive.
  • Location of Installation: Installing rails in difficult-to-reach areas or on uneven surfaces may raise costs due to increased labor time.
  • Local Building Codes: Adhering to specific local regulations and codes in Fairfield, CA can affect the cost due to required compliance measures.
  • Labor Rates: The cost of labor can vary based on the expertise and rates of local contractors in Fairfield, CA.

Common Tasks and Costs

Task Description Average Cost (USD)
Basic Handrail Installation $200 - $500
Custom Handrail Design $500 - $1,200
Outdoor Ramp Rail Installation $300 - $800
Indoor Stair Rail Installation $250 - $700
ADA Compliant Handrail Installation $400 - $1,000
